- Шикарные кнопки для ваших Windows Forms
- Принципы дизайна кнопок в Windows Forms
- 1. Четкость и контрастность
- 2. Consistency (MAINTAIN CONSISTENT DESIGN)
- 3. Удобный размер и расположение
- Значение дизайна кнопок в пользовательском интерфейсе Windows Forms
- Функциональные требования к дизайну кнопок в Windows Forms
- Расположение и размер кнопок в Windows Forms для оптимальной пользовательской навигации
- Использование цвета, текста и значков для привлечения внимания к кнопкам в Windows Forms
- Создание эффектных стилей кнопок в Windows Forms для повышения пользовательского опыта
- Адаптация дизайна кнопок в Windows Forms для различных разрешений экрана
Шикарные кнопки для ваших Windows Forms
Кнопки являются важной частью пользовательского интерфейса при разработке приложений на платформе Windows Forms. Их дизайн имеет огромное значение, поскольку от него зависит удобство использования приложения, а также его эстетическая привлекательность.
В данной статье мы рассмотрим некоторые из лучших практик и советов по дизайну кнопок в Windows Forms, которые помогут создать привлекательный и функциональный пользовательский интерфейс.
1. Размер и пропорции кнопок
При выборе размера кнопок стоит учитывать их контекст и использование. Крупные кнопки обычно используются для основных действий и привлекают больше внимания пользователей, в то время как мелкие кнопки могут использоваться для менее важных действий. Важно подобрать пропорции, чтобы кнопки выглядели гармонично в интерфейсе.
2. Цвет и стиль кнопок
Выбор цвета и стиля кнопок также влияет на восприятие пользователей. Лучше всего использовать цветовую схему, соответствующую общему дизайну приложения, для создания единого и стильного интерфейса. Также стоит помнить о доступности цветов для пользователей с ограниченными возможностями зрения, предоставляя достаточный контраст между фоном и текстом кнопок.
3. Иконки и текст на кнопках
Добавление иконок и текста на кнопки помогает пользователю лучше понимать их функцию и назначение. Иконки могут быть использованы для идентификации различных действий, а текст дополняет их, делая интерфейс более понятным.
4. Поведение кнопок
При разработке кнопок важно принимать во внимание их поведение при взаимодействии с пользователем. Например, кнопка может менять цвет или стиль при наведении курсора, чтобы подчеркнуть свою активность. Также можно предусмотреть анимацию или звуковые эффекты, чтобы улучшить визуальное впечатление.
Принципы дизайна кнопок в Windows Forms
При создании кнопок в Windows Forms следует учитывать несколько принципов дизайна, которые помогут сделать их более эффективными и привлекательными для пользователей.
1. Четкость и контрастность
Кнопки должны быть четкими и хорошо видимыми на фоне остального интерфейса. Используйте контрастные цвета для кнопок и текста на них, чтобы они легко привлекали внимание пользователей. Важно также обеспечить достаточный констраст между фоновым цветом кнопки и цветом текста или иконки на ней.
2. Consistency (MAINTAIN CONSISTENT DESIGN)
It is important to maintain a consistent design across all buttons in your Windows Forms application. Use the same style, size, and color scheme for all buttons to create a cohesive and professional look. Consistency helps users to quickly recognize and understand the purpose of each button, improving usability and navigation.
3. Удобный размер и расположение
Размер и расположение кнопок имеют важное значение для их удобства использования. Кнопки должны быть достаточно большими, чтобы пользователи могли легко нажимать на них без ошибок. Рекомендуется использовать стандартный размер кнопок в Windows Forms и располагать их на экране таким образом, чтобы они были доступны для пользователя даже при использовании устройств с маленьким экраном или высокой плотностью пикселей.
Учитывая эти принципы дизайна, вы сможете создать кнопки в своих Windows Forms приложениях, которые привлекут внимание пользователей, будут удобны для использования и помогут сделать ваше приложение более профессиональным визуально.
Значение дизайна кнопок в пользовательском интерфейсе Windows Forms
Когда пользователь видит кнопку, он ожидает, что она будет компонентом интерактивного интерфейса, переходом в другое состояние или выполнением определенного действия. Поэтому важно, чтобы кнопка имела достаточно привлекательный и понятный дизайн, который позволит пользователям моментально распознавать ее и знать, что она делает.
В Windows Forms предоставляется ряд встроенных элементов управления для создания кнопок, и важно выбрать подходящий дизайн для каждой кнопки. Цвет, форма, размер и расположение кнопки могут быть разными и должны быть привлекательными и удобочитаемыми. Кнопки также могут содержать иконки, текст или оба элемента, чтобы добавить еще больше информации и облегчить понимание назначения кнопки.
Важно помнить, что дизайн кнопок в пользовательском интерфейсе должен соответствовать общему стилю и тематике приложения. Например, если приложение имеет современный и минималистичный интерфейс, кнопки должны быть такими же, с чистыми линиями и простыми формами. Если же приложение имеет более традиционный или насыщенный дизайн, кнопки могут быть более декоративными и украшенными. Главное, чтобы каждая кнопка была легко распознаваемой и служила своей цели в интерфейсе.
Функциональные требования к дизайну кнопок в Windows Forms
Во-первых, кнопки должны быть достаточно крупными и наглядными, чтобы пользователи могли легко их различать и нажимать. Размер кнопок должен быть достаточно большим, чтобы пользователь мог легко найти нужную кнопку на экране и не ошибиться при нажатии. Важно также учесть тип устройства, на котором будет запущено приложение, чтобы размер кнопок соответствовал разрешению экрана и возможностям устройства.
Во-вторых, кнопки должны быть наглядно отображены, чтобы пользователи сразу понимали их функциональность и назначение. Они должны быть выделены цветом, шрифтом или иными графическими элементами, чтобы привлечь внимание пользователя. Кроме того, кнопки должны быть понятными по названию или иконке, чтобы пользователи могли сразу определить, что произойдет при их нажатии. Важно избегать слишком сложных и запутанных дизайнов кнопок, чтобы не вызывать путаницу у пользователей.
- Кнопки должны быть оформлены в одном стиле с другими элементами пользовательского интерфейса, чтобы создать единый и цельный дизайн.
- Важно, чтобы кнопки имели различные состояния – нажатую, активную и неактивную – чтобы пользователь мог понять, какие кнопки доступны для нажатия и какие нет.
- Кнопки должны реагировать на взаимодействие пользователя – изменяться при наведении курсора, менять цвет или отображать визуальную отдачу, чтобы пользователю было понятно, что его действия вызвали реакцию приложения.
Следуя этим функциональным требованиям, разработчики Windows Forms могут создавать эффективный и интуитивно понятный дизайн кнопок, обеспечивая комфортное использование приложений для пользователей.
Расположение и размер кнопок в Windows Forms для оптимальной пользовательской навигации
Первое, что следует учесть, это контекст использования. В зависимости от типа приложения и его функциональности, кнопки могут располагаться по-разному. Например, для приложений с большим количеством функций и опций, лучше использовать группировку кнопок по разделам или категориям. Такая организация позволит пользователю быстро находить нужные ему функции и совершать операции без лишних усилий.
Второй аспект — это размер кнопок. Здесь важно найти баланс между слишком маленькими кнопками, которые могут быть сложно нажать, особенно на сенсорных устройствах, и слишком большими кнопками, которые занимают много места и визуально перегружают интерфейс.
- Для кнопок, которые пользователю необходимо часто нажимать, рекомендуется использовать размер, который обеспечивает удобность нажатия как с помощью мыши, так и пальцем на сенсорных экранах.
- Для кнопок, которые не требуют такой частой активности, размер можно уменьшить, чтобы освободить больше пространства на экране и сделать интерфейс более компактным.
Также стоит учитывать эргономику интерфейса. Кнопки должны быть размещены таким образом, чтобы пользователю было легко добраться до них как на компьютере, так и на мобильном устройстве. Например, на сенсорных экранах удобно размещать кнопки в нижней части экрана, чтобы пользователь мог легко дотянуться до них большим пальцем без необходимости менять свою позицию.
Оптимальное расположение и размер кнопок в Windows Forms играют важную роль в создании удобного и интуитивно понятного пользовательского интерфейса. Следуя рекомендациям по учету контекста использования, размеру и эргономике интерфейса, можно создать приложение, которое будет приятно использовать и не вызывать негативных эмоций у пользователей.
Использование цвета, текста и значков для привлечения внимания к кнопкам в Windows Forms
Один из способов использования цвета для привлечения внимания к кнопкам — это использование ярких и контрастных цветов. Например, можно использовать яркие цвета, такие как красный или оранжевый, чтобы кнопка выделялась на фоне. Такой подход позволяет пользователю быстро определить, какая кнопка выполняет определенное действие.
Текст также играет важную роль в привлечении внимания к кнопкам. Четкое и информативное описание действия, которое будет выполнено при нажатии на кнопку, поможет пользователю легко ориентироваться в интерфейсе и выполнять нужные действия. Также можно использовать различные стили текста, такие как полужирный или курсив, чтобы выделить важное сообщение на кнопке.
Значки на кнопках также являются эффективным способом привлечения внимания. Значки могут быть наглядным представлением действия, которое будет выполнено при нажатии на кнопку. Например, значок корзины может указывать на то, что при нажатии на кнопку будет произведено удаление элемента. Использование значков помогает пользователю быстро распознать функциональность кнопки и принять решение о необходимости ее нажатия.
В итоге, использование цвета, текста и значков на кнопках в Windows Forms — это важный аспект разработки пользовательского интерфейса. Они помогают привлечь внимание пользователя, легко ориентироваться в интерфейсе и выполнять нужные действия. Комбинация всех этих элементов способствует созданию привлекательного и интуитивно понятного приложения.
Создание эффектных стилей кнопок в Windows Forms для повышения пользовательского опыта
Первым шагом в создании эффектных стилей кнопок является выбор подходящего дизайна. Дизайн кнопок должен быть привлекательным, современным и соответствовать общему стилю приложения. Вы можете использовать различные такие эффекты, как градиенты, тени, закругленные углы и другие визуальные детали, чтобы придать кнопкам уникальный вид. Важно помнить, что дизайн кнопок должен быть понятным и не вызывать путаницу у пользователей.
Помимо дизайна, важно также задать правильные взаимодействия для кнопок. Например, можно добавить эффект нажатия при клике на кнопку, чтобы она реагировала на действия пользователя. Это можно сделать, изменяя цвет фона или добавляя анимации. Также можно добавить всплывающие подсказки или изменять состояние кнопки при наведении курсора мыши. Все эти мелкие детали помогут сделать ваши кнопки более интерактивными, что положительно повлияет на пользовательский опыт.
Создание эффектных стилей кнопок в Windows Forms может быть увлекательным и творческим процессом. Важно не забывать о потребностях пользователей и стремиться к созданию удобного, интуитивно понятного и привлекательного дизайна. Это поможет сделать ваше приложение более привлекательным и удобным в использовании для пользователей.
Адаптация дизайна кнопок в Windows Forms для различных разрешений экрана
При разработке приложения, особенно с учетом разнообразия устройств и разрешений экранов, необходимо учитывать фактор адаптивности интерфейса. Кнопки должны быть достаточно крупными для удобного нажатия, но в то же время не должны занимать слишком много места на экране.
Важно помнить о том, что разрешение экрана не только влияет на размер кнопки, но и на ее внешний вид. Шрифт, цвет и стиль кнопки должны быть адаптированы таким образом, чтобы обеспечить оптимальную читаемость и хорошую видимость кнопки на экране.
Одним из наиболее эффективных способов адаптации дизайна кнопок в Windows Forms является использование относительных размеров и позиций элементов управления. Это позволяет кнопкам автоматически изменять свои размеры и расположение в зависимости от разрешения экрана.
Также важным аспектом является выбор подходящего шрифта и цвета для текста на кнопках. Шрифт должен быть достаточно крупным для удобного чтения, а цвет должен обеспечивать хорошую контрастность, чтобы текст был хорошо виден на фоне кнопки.
В итоге, успешная адаптация дизайна кнопок в Windows Forms позволяет пользователю комфортно взаимодействовать с приложением на различных устройствах и экранах. Благодаря правильному подходу к адаптивности, пользовательский интерфейс становится более удобным и интуитивно понятным.